Technical Specifications

Side-by-side comparison of FireStream 9170 and GeForce RTX 4060 Laptop GPU

AMD

FireStream 9170

The FireStream 9170 is manufactured by AMD. It was released in June 23 2010. It features the TeraScale 2 architecture. The core clock speed is 825 MHz. It has 1600 shading units. The thermal design power (TDP) is 225W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 647 points.

NVIDIA

GeForce RTX 4060 Laptop GPU

The GeForce RTX 4060 Laptop GPU is manufactured by NVIDIA. It was released in May 18 2023. It features the Ada Lovelace architecture. The core clock ranges from 2310 MHz to 2535 MHz. It has 4352 shading units. The thermal design power (TDP) is 160W. Manufactured using 5 nm process technology. It features 34 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 17,400 points. Launch price was $399.

Graphics Performance

In G3D Mark, the FireStream 9170 scores 647 versus the GeForce RTX 4060 Laptop GPU's 17,400 — the GeForce RTX 4060 Laptop GPU leads by 2589.3%. The FireStream 9170 is built on TeraScale 2 while the GeForce RTX 4060 Laptop GPU uses Ada Lovelace, both on 40 nm vs 5 nm. Shader units: 1,600 (FireStream 9170) vs 4,352 (GeForce RTX 4060 Laptop GPU). Raw compute: 2.64 TFLOPS (FireStream 9170) vs 22.06 TFLOPS (GeForce RTX 4060 Laptop GPU).

Video Memory (VRAM)

The FireStream 9170 comes with 512 MB of VRAM, while the GeForce RTX 4060 Laptop GPU has 8 GB. The GeForce RTX 4060 Laptop GPU offers 1500%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 64-bit vs 128-bit. L2 Cache: 0.5 MB (FireStream 9170) vs 32 MB (GeForce RTX 4060 Laptop GPU) — the GeForce RTX 4060 Laptop GPU has significantly larger on-die cache to reduce VRAM reliance.
